Main files (what to check first)

  • Animation : All the stuff to animate sprites in there
  • Camera : The camera of the scene
  • Collisions : Handles collisions / Polygonal Colliders
  • Coordinates : All the coordinates operations in there
  • FramerateManager : Handles time / deltatime / framerate
  • Game : Plays the game
  • GameObject : An Object that can contains those components : Animator, Sprite, PolygonalCollider, Script
  • KeyBind : Associates keys with actions
  • Sprite : Primitive drawable element
  • ObEngine : main function inside
  • Package & Workspace : Pretty much the same thing, works with the PathResolver
  • PathResolver : Really important class that "mounts" (see wiki) folders
  • Scene : Scene-like container
  • Script : All the Lua binding stuff in there
  • Toolkit : Nice terminal to help with project management
  • Triggers : Triggers / Events for the GameObjects

How can I contribute

Reporting bugs

If you test the engine and encounter a bug, you can :

  • Check if the issue doesn't already exist on github
  • Report it on Github (Specify OS, compiler if you compiled it yourself, version of the engine)
  • Discuss it on the Discord (#issues channel)

Ask for new features

If you feel like there is a missing feature come and discuss it with us on the Discord (#features channel)

Create new features yourself

You're an adventurer ? Nice ! If you developped something for the engine you can do a pull request, I'll try to validate it quickly if everything is in order :)
